PRISON Officers Association (POA) president Gerard Gordon has defended the integrity of prison officers against statements by anyone trying to suggest the reason why inmates were relocated from the Maximum Security Prison (MSP) in Arouca to military facilities in Chaguaramas during the state of emergency (SoE) was because security had been compromised at the prisons.
On July 18, Attorney General John Jeremie said government fully endorsed the calling of the SoE from midnight on July 17 to thwart what he said was a plot hatched by criminal elements operating inside the prison system, to threaten the lives of ordinary citizens, members of the justice system and law-enforcement officers.
CoP Allister Guevarro made similar comments earlier on July 18.
